Municipal Corporations - Validity Of Covenant To Maintain Parking Meters In Bond Issue To Finance Off-Street Parking Facilities, William G. Cloon, Jr. S.Ed.
Municipal Corporations - Validity Of Covenant To Maintain Parking Meters In Bond Issue To Finance Off-Street Parking Facilities, William G. Cloon, Jr. S.Ed.
Michigan Law Review
An act of the state legislature authorized the issuance of municipal bonds to finance off-street parking facilities. The city was authorized to pledge revenue from existing on-street parking facilities to service the bonds but was to retain the right to change the location of the parking meters and other on-street facilities for enumerated reasons so long as the change did not materially lessen the revenue to be derived from those facilities. Acting in pursuance of authority granted by the enabling act, the city covenanted to maintain its parking meters subject to the reservations required by the act. In an action …
Us Army Quartermaster Intelligence Agency, Robert Bolin , Depositor
Us Army Quartermaster Intelligence Agency, Robert Bolin , Depositor
Department of Defense Military Intelligence
Historical Data Cards were used to record the organizational history of units within the Army. This card was provided to Robert Bolin by the US Army Institute of Heraldry in 1985.
The Quartermaster Intelligence Agency (QIA) was established on 1 March 1955. QIA was a special-purpose military unit assigned to the Quartermaster General. The Quartermaster General was the general in charge of the Quartermaster Corps (QMC). The functions of the QIA were described as “… collects, produces, evaluates, analyzes, interprets, maintains, and disseminates foreign intelliency [sic] necessary to fulfill the missions and functions of the QMC and to meet requirements …

Thunderstorms And Tornadoes Of February 1, 1955, Jean T. Lee
Thunderstorms And Tornadoes Of February 1, 1955, Jean T. Lee
NOAA Technical Reports and Related Materials
The purpose of this paper is to describe and illustrate some of the features that are of particular interest in the forecasting of one of the most death-dealing series of convective storms of the 1950s that occurred during the afternoon and evening of February 1, 1955. This series of severe storms included tornadoes, destructive winds, hail, and heavy rain that first struck near Marianata, Arkansas, then roared through Commerce Landing, Mississippi and northern Mississippi. then moved on to near Huntsville, Alabama.
Includes features at the surface, at 850 mb, 700 mb, and 500 mb, and upper air conditions, along with …
